When is the acquisition program baseline (apb) prepared?

The Acquisition Program Baseline (APB) is prepared during the initial phase of an acquisition program, typically after the completion of the analysis of alternatives and before the program enters the development phase. It is established to define the program's cost, schedule, and performance objectives, serving as a key management tool throughout the program's lifecycle. The APB is updated at critical milestones to reflect any changes in the program's goals or parameters.

What is a baseline audit in health and safety?

A baseline audit in health and safety is an audit of all or part of a health and safety program, the results of which will be used as a point of comparison (a baseline) when a future audit is performed. With a baseline audit in the record, it is possible after future audits to tell whether there have been improvements or declines in health and safety performance.
